Ingredients

  • 1 (32-ounce) bag frozen homestyle meatballs
  • 4 tablespoons butter
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 3 cups beef broth
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• F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ions

Step 1: Add Meatballs

Place frozen meatballs into the crock pot.

Step 2: Make the Gravy

In a medium saucepan melt butter over medium heat.

Whisk in flour and cook for 1 minute.

Slowly whisk in beef broth until smooth.

Add:

  • Worcestershire sauce
  • garlic powder
  • onion powder
  • black pepper

Simmer for 3-5 minutes.

Whisk in heavy cream.

Continue stirring until smooth and creamy.

Step 3: Combine

Pour the gravy over the frozen meatballs.

Stir gently to coat.

Step 4: Slow Cook

Cover and cook:

  • LOW for 4-5 hours
    or
  • HIGH for 2-3 hours

Step 5: Serve

Garnish with fresh parsley.

Serve over:

  • mashed potatoes
  • egg noodles
  • rice

Recipe Details

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 4-5 hours
  • Total Time: About 5 hours
  • Servings: 6

Tips for the Best Crock Pot Swedish Meatballs

Use Homestyle Meatballs

Homestyle meatballs work best for traditional Swedish meatball flavor.

Whisk the Gravy Well

A smooth gravy creates the best texture.

Don’t Overcook

Once heated through, the meatballs are ready to serve.

Add Extra Cream

For an even richer sauce, stir in an extra splash of cream before serving.

 IMG_2977-1-576x1024 Crock Pot Swedish Meatballs

Variations

Mushroom Swedish Meatballs

Add sliced mushrooms to the crock pot.

Garlic Parmesan Swedish Meatballs

Add grated Parmesan cheese before serving.

Extra Creamy Version

Increase heavy cream to 1 1/2 cups.

Party Appetizer Version

Serve directly from the slow cooker with toothpicks.

Storage

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Reheat gently on the stovetop or microwave.
